PAS CHATT 594: Integrated Health III

Credits 2

This course prepares students to deliver care in various patient settings. Providing care for emergencies and urgent complaints in the emergency department and urgent care center will be covered. Comprehensive operative care includes preoperative, intraoperative, and postoperative management. Students will learn to care for hospitalized patients by understanding admission and discharge criteria, nutritional support, and prevention strategies such as deep vein thrombosis (DVT) prophylaxis. The course introduces key concepts in critical care, including fluid management. Emphasis is placed on effective collaboration and referral with a multidisciplinary healthcare team across emergency, surgical, inpatient, and critical care settings to ensure safe, coordinated, and patient-centered care. This course is delivered in person on campus. Pre-requisite(s): Completion of Semester 2 of LMU Chat PA Program
